All VPMA Certified WDI Inspectors must recertify every two years. To maintain your VPMA WDI Inspector certification, you must complete a recertification course before June 30 of your expiration year. This course extends your certification for another two years—no exam required if your certification is still active. You’ll be done by 3:15 PM. If your certification has expired, don’t worry—you can still attend and take the exam to renew your credentials. You can also earn recertification credits in 7B and 60 in VA, DC, MD, NC, and WV.
